Do iphones support wireless charging

1. Make sure your iPhone supports wireless charging. Wireless charging has been built into the iPhone since the iPhone 8, and you only need to update the corresponding software version. Make sure your phone supports wireless charging by checking Apple's website or the phone's manual. Get a compatible wireless charging pad. Choose a wireless charging device that meets Apple's standards and make sure it is the latest model to guarantee the best compatibility.

3. First, make sure you have a compatible Apple device and a wireless charger. The Apple Wireless Charger is suitable for Apple devices that support wireless charging, such as iPhone 8 and newer versions, AirPods with charging cases, etc. At the same time, you need an Apple original wireless charger or a third-party wireless charger certified by Apple.
